About this calculator

The Culinary Measurement Converter is an online tool that quickly converts between teaspoon, tablespoon, cup, milliliters, and liters. Ideal for recipes using different measurement systems, such as American (cups and spoons) and Brazilian (milliliters). Simply enter the value and select the source and target units to get the instant result.

The tool uses the following standard equivalences: 1 cup = 240 ml, 1 tablespoon = 15 ml, 1 teaspoon = 5 ml, and 1 fluid ounce = 29.57 ml. These conversions are widely accepted in cooking, though slight variations exist by country. The converter helps adapt international recipes, ensure correct proportions in baking, and avoid dosing errors.

Use this converter when adjusting a recipe from a foreign cookbook, converting liquid ingredients to household measures, or checking equivalences between spoons and cups. It is especially useful for beginners who lack a scale or precise measuring tools. Note that dry ingredients (like flour) have different densities, so this tool is recommended only for liquids and ingredients with similar density to water.

Cautions: Converting cups to grams depends on ingredient density. For flour, 1 cup equals approximately 120 g, but this varies. Whenever possible, use a scale for dry ingredients. Additionally, tablespoon and teaspoon capacities may differ between countries (the US tablespoon is 14.79 ml, while the Brazilian is 15 ml). This tool adopts the Brazilian standard of 15 ml for tablespoons.

Frequently asked questions

How many ml are in one cup?

One cup equals 240 ml, according to the standard used in this tool.

Can I use this converter for dry ingredients like flour?

Not recommended, as density varies. For dry ingredients, use a scale.

What is the difference between a tablespoon and a teaspoon?

1 tablespoon = 15 ml and 1 teaspoon = 5 ml, so 3 teaspoons equal 1 tablespoon.

How do I convert fluid ounces to ml?

Multiply the number of fluid ounces by 29.57. For example, 8 fl oz = 236.56 ml.

Does this tool use the US cup or the Brazilian cup?

It uses the US cup (240 ml), which is most common in international recipes. The Brazilian cup is 200 ml.
